Just thought I'd post up a thread to discuss the RTD dragon trip and plans. There is an official discussion site on s2ki, so go there for your registration and information. In a nutshell, the event is being set up this year so the BBQ is lunch Saturday so people can make a head start to get home for Mother's Day Sunday. The banquet is Friday night.
For those who want to pound the roads around the dragon and beyond have all day Thursday and Friday. Saturday is the roll out in the morning. Tentative plans are to leave Fontana after the BBQ (Saturday) to get a head start on the trip home, stopping partway so the drive over to Canada will be get everyone home well before dinner Sunday- that way mom will be happy.
On Saturday there are 2 ideas for the drive home- one long tour to the hotel and one longer tour to the hotel. We'll post up plans and road maps in the coming months so you can decide.
I'd like to do Devil's Triangle on the way home, which will make for a longer drive on Saturday- but the plan is to avoid i75.
Plans are pretty fluid, but post up ideas and if you have questions.
